What Kind Of Ticks Are Common in Lake Palestine, TX
Ticks are common parasitic pests that are found living and breeding across the United States; these parasites tend to feed on a wide variety of hosts giving them the unfortunate ability to carry a wide range of dangerous diseases and bacteria. In our area of East Texas the American dog tick, blacklegged tick, and brown dog tick are the most prevalent species found.
- Adult American dog ticks have flat, oval-shaped bodies that grow to about 1/8 inch in length, increasing in size after feeding. Their bodies are brown in color with white or yellow markings. American dog ticks are responsible for spreading diseases that can make people and pets sick including Rocky Mountain Spotted Fever.
- Brown dog ticks are reddish-brown in color and their bodies have a flattened oval shape. Before feeding, adults are about 1/8th of an inch long; after feeding they can expand to about 1/2 of an inch and turn more bluish-gray in color. Brown dog ticks prefer to feed on canine blood, but they do at times feed on people transmitting diseases like Rocky Mountain Spotted fever.
- Blacklegged Ticks (deer ticks) have a very small oval-shaped body that is brownish-orange in color, their black legs are darker in color than their body. Deer ticks are considered to be very dangerous to both people and pets because they spread several diseases including the potentially debilitating Lyme disease.
